    Pieter Hoff retired from the flower export business seven years ago. Now, he is trying to help people grow trees and plants in the desert—and save water.

    In many places, much of the freshwater supply is used for irrigation. Yet most of that water may be lost through evaporation(蒸發(fā)) into the air. So Pieter Hoff has invented a simple plastic device called the Groasis Waterboxx. He says “If you look at nature, and I give an example, if you look to the Rocky Mountains, you find trees all over the mountains. So trees are actually able to grow on rocks. They have very strong roots. ”

    He says the trick is that nature does not dig a hole like we humans do to plant seeds. Nature plants the seeds through birds or animals on top of the soil. Their waste then acts as a cover. It prevents the humidity(濕度) in the soil from evaporating. The Dutch inventor says he is simply copying that system.

    Some people call the Waterboxx a water battery. The cover has deep ridges. These collect rainwater. But the device is designed to collect water even when there is no rain. The cover gets cold during the night and creates condensation(凝結).

    The water is collected through two holes through which water is carried to the soil. Pieter Hoff says the nice thing is that, once collected, the water is not able to evaporate anymore.

    The roots of the plant may have to grow several meters deep to reach groundwater. Once growth is established, the box can be removed and used to start another planting.

    Pieter Hoff says he is now doing experiments with twenty thousand Waterboxxes in countries including Pakistan, Ecuador and the United States. The reusable box now sells for about fifteen dollars.

Color use in nature

Nature is very colorful, full of different hues(色調)that delight the eye. What makes these colors and why do they exist?

Causes of Colors in Nature

Colors in nature are formed in two ways. Pigments, like the melanin in skin and many animal furs, produce most blacks, browns, reds and yellows. Most plants are green due to chlorophyll(葉綠素). Other colors are caused by structure, like many greens, blues, and whites. Blue bird’s feathers actually contain black pigment, but their structure causes them to appear blue. The scattering of light by tiny dust particles in the air, viewed against the black background of space, makes the sky look blue too.

Color Use in Plants

Color has a great effect on the survival of plants and animals. Flowers have bright hues and patterns to attract insects. These insects move from one flower to another, making sure seeds are produced. Bees can see colors we cannot, i.e. ultraviolet, and follow these patterns of stripes or dots to the inside of the flower.  

Not only flowers but also fruits use color for the good of the plant. An unripe fruit mixes in with the leaves, but ripe berries contrast, becoming more appealing to the creatures who eat them. Birds are especially drawn to red fruit, and in turn help the plant by broadcasting its seeds.

Camouflage(偽裝)in Nature

Many colors and patterns camouflage animals who want to avoid enemies. Some animals have damaging shapes to break up their outline, so an enemy will not recognize them. The eye, a very recognizable animal characteristic, is often disguised by a black stripe or patch. Light color below makes up for the shadow on the underside of many fish, amphibians and mammals.

Some animals even change colors to better camouflage themselves, seasonally like the snowshoe hare.

Warning Coloration and Mimicry(動態(tài)偽裝)

Warning colors make an animal more visible rather than hidden. These usually indicate a negative aspect of the animal, like the bad taste of a monarch butterfly, smelly smell or painful bite of a bee. Usually black and a contrasting color (white, yellow, orange or red) form a striking pattern in these creatures, and frighten their enemies away. Nature is tricky, though, and sometimes harmless creatures pretend the patterns of harmful ones to scare off animals living on meat too.  

Social Coloration in Nature

Sometimes coloration is important socially. Male birds, typically more colorful, defend their territories and attract females. Eggs may use color and pattern to remain hidden. When they hatch, parents feed the nestlings when they see the bright pattern in their gaping mouths.

Taking a closer look at nature throws light on how color is used in marvelous ways!
